Abstract

The utility model relates to a hydraulic gas extracting check valve, which is composed of a valve cover, a valve body, a pin, a rocker, a vale clack and a hydraulic operation device outside the valve body. Characteristically, angle of sealing pair of the valve formed by sealed surface of the valve clack and sealed surface of valve base is 25 degree. The rocker is provided with the pin. A pressure plate which is used for stirring the pin is arranged on relative position of a transmission shaft which is connected with a piston rod of the hydraulic operation device outside the valve body through a lever. For the sealing pair of the valve formed by sealed surface of the valve clack and sealed surface of valve base is 25 degree, structural length of the valve can be largely reduced. The valve is characterized in simply structure and light weight, and load of pipe is reduced. The valve can be quickly opened and closed, and the valve can be processed by special clamping fixture of common lathe. The hydraulic operation device outside the valve body can be automatically controlled with agile reaction and reliable performance. The foresaid valve can be closed within 0.5 second when accident occurs in steam turbine set in order to protect steam turbine generator and prevent accidents. Therefore, the utility model is suitable using and of steam turbine set of small thermal power station or heat supplying and gas extracting pipeline of thermoelectric plant.

Background technique
Steam turbine is in order to prevent that steam turbine set is when the removal of load suddenly with the safety check that draws gas, pressure in the steam turbine reduces suddenly, steam blows back in the steam turbine in exhaust tube and each heater, cause the unexpected reverse-starting braking operation running of turbine blade of changeing high speed rotating with per minute more than 3000, and then cause turbine vane is smashed, cause the serious accident of equipment such as damaging steam turbine generator and casualties, and prevent the heater system pipe leakage, and water hammer accident takes place.This Special valve China relies on import always, domestic also have produce the safety check that draws gas, mostly to adopt the sealing pair angle be 5 °, the cast iron or the Normal Steel Casting valve body of orthodrome structure to valve body, and the easy ponding of the body cavity of this structure does not particularly reach in 0.5 second throttle down rapidly.Both at home and abroad sealing pair is also arranged is 30 ° to valve, but 30 ° of valve bodies are difficult to processing by analysis, and opening resistance is big, and the circulation area of medium is little, influences the working efficiency of valve.

Embodiment
As shown in Figure 1 to Figure 3, the steam-extracting type safety check that surges that the utility model provides, comprise valve gap 1, valve body 2, bearing pin 3, rocking bar 4 and flap 5, flap 5 links to each other with rocking bar 4, rocking bar 4 links to each other with bearing pin 3, the outside gyropilot of this valve is for surging, unlike the prior art be: the flap sealing surface is 25 ° with the valve seal pair angle of sealing surface of seat formation; One pin 11 is set on the rocking bar 4, and the pressing plate 10 that is used for stirring pin 11 is arranged on transmission shaft 12 corresponding positions, and transmission shaft 12 links to each other with piston rod 7 in the valve body outer liquid cylinder pressure 8 by lever 6.In addition, for avoiding producing hydrophobic phenomenon in the using process, the bottom design of above-mentioned valve body 2 is the cylindrical shape that matches with pipe shape.
The working principle of this hydraulic control air exhausting type safety check is: at first hydraulic control steam-extracting type safety check is installed on the pipeline according to direction shown in the valve body upward arrow, when pressure medium on the pipeline descended suddenly, valve can be closed automatically.Can close rapidly for making valve, the hydraulic control gyropilot of valve body outer installment, its oil hydraulic cylinder planted agent often keeps the liquid of certain pressure (0.02MPa) so that cylinder body remains full of state, and answers running check, prevents that cylinder body and pipeline from having the situation of leakage to take place.When controlling automatically, understand the switch situation of valve for ease of valve in the control room, valve is provided with travel control switch.For understanding the open and-shut mode of valve at any time, valve is provided with the switch direction board.Hydraulic actuator is started working when hydraulic pressure reaches 0.6MPa, piston rod 7 is descending, lever 6 drives transmission shaft 12 rotations, the pin 11 that pressing plate 10 on the transmission shaft 12 hits on the rocking bar 4 fast impels the rocking bar 4 rapid flaps 5 that drive to move downward, coincideing at 0.5 second internal valve flap seal face and sealing surface of seat makes valve closing rapidly, reaches the purpose of protection steam turbine; When hydraulic pressure dropped to 0.02MPa, spring 9 shrank by spring force, and oil hydraulic cylinder automatically resets, and can not influence the automatic unlatching of valve.
